Parties Obligated and Benefitted. (a) Subject to the limitations set forth in clauses (b) and (c) below, this Agreement will be binding upon the parties and their respective assigns and successors in interest and will inure solely to the benefit of the parties and their respective assigns and successors in interest, and no other Person will be entitled to any of the benefits conferred by this Agreement.
